What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Booth Renter (Salon Professional), and why are they important?

To thrive as a Booth Renter in a salon, you need a valid cosmetology or barbering license, strong technical skills in your specialty (hair, nails, or skin), and a solid understanding of business operations. Familiarity with salon booking software, payment processing systems, and relevant sanitation protocols is essential. Exceptional client service, self-motivation, and effective communication make a booth renter stand out. These skills ensure you can attract and retain clients, manage your independent business effectively, and maintain compliance with industry standards.

What are the common responsibilities and expectations for professionals renting a booth in a salon or trade show environment?

As a booth renter, you are typically considered an independent contractor responsible for managing your own business within a shared space. This includes handling client scheduling, payments, ordering supplies, and maintaining your work area according to salon or event guidelines. You'll have the freedom to set your own hours and pricing, but you are also expected to follow any rules set by the venue owner and collaborate professionally with other booth renters. It's important to build strong relationships with both clients and colleagues to succeed in this dynamic environment.

What is booth rental in the beauty industry?

Booth rental refers to a business arrangement where beauty professionals, such as hairstylists or cosmetologists, rent a workspace or 'booth' within a salon or spa. Instead of being an employee, the professional operates as an independent contractor, managing their own clients, schedule, and finances. Booth renters typically pay a fixed rental fee to the salon owner and are responsible for their own taxes, supplies, and insurance. This arrangement offers more flexibility and autonomy compared to traditional employment but also comes with additional business responsibilities.
